As we reported yesterday, a teaser site and some “leaks” (most likely strategically placed by Activision) hinted that the reveal of Call of Duty: Black Ops 6 was imminent. In particular, the teaser website thetruthlies.com features a couple brief video clips that hint at the tone of the upcoming game. One of the videos shows some group making a statement by putting blindfolds reading “The Truth Lies” on the Presidential noggins of Mount Rushmore. Another teaser on the site shows the same group putting up posters featuring an image of the blindfolded Mt. Rushmore.
While we’ll have to wait for the full reveal of Call of Duty: Black Ops 6 in June, rumors have stated it will be your typical shadowy Treyarch tale set in and around the first Gulf War. Whether it focuses specifically on the Gulf War of just that general early 90s period, remains to be seen. The Black Ops 6 Direct will also likely reveal how Microsoft plans to sell the game, as there are strong rumors they plan to put it on Game Pass on Day 1, which would obviously be a big shakeup for the series.
